Tennis Program Manager information

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a tennis program manager?

To thrive as a Tennis Program Manager, you need expertise in tennis coaching, program development, and management, typically supported by a background in sports management and relevant coaching certifications. Familiarity with scheduling software, registration systems, and industry-standard coaching certifications (such as USTA or PTR) is often required. Strong leadership, communication, and organizational skills distinguish top performers in this role. These abilities are crucial for effectively running programs, ensuring participant engagement, and maintaining a high level of service within tennis organizations.

What are some common challenges faced by tennis program managers in balancing administrative duties with on-court responsibilities?

Tennis Program Managers often juggle a variety of tasks, from scheduling and organizing tournaments to coaching players and overseeing facility operations. One common challenge is efficiently managing time between strategic planning, staff coordination, and hands-on instruction. It requires strong organizational skills to ensure smooth program delivery and participant satisfaction. Additionally, adapting to fluctuating enrollment numbers and maintaining high-quality programming while staying within budget are typical hurdles. Successful managers prioritize effective communication, delegation, and time management to meet both administrative and on-court demands.

What does a tennis program manager do?

A Tennis Program Manager oversees the planning, development, and execution of tennis programs at clubs, schools, or community centers. They are responsible for managing coaching staff, organizing tournaments and events, and ensuring that all programs meet the needs of participants of varying skill levels. Additionally, they handle budgeting, scheduling, marketing, and liaising with stakeholders to grow the program. Their role is vital in creating a positive and engaging environment for tennis players.

Job Title: High School Varsity Tennis Coach

Job Classification: Exempt

Supervisor: Principal and School Athletic Director

Job Objectives: The Head Tennis Coach is responsible for the overall leadership, development, and success of the high school tennis program. This includes organizing, instructing, and supervising student-athletes while promoting academic achievement, sportsmanship, and a positive team culture. The Head Coach will oversee all aspects of the program, including student athlete development, program promotion, and compliance with all governing bodies.

Minimum Qualifications:
    Prior tennis coaching experience (high school or higher preferred)
    Demonstrated knowledge of tennis fundamentals, strategies, and skill development
    Strong leadership, communication, and organizational skills
    Ability to build positive relationships with student-athletes, parents, staff, and community stakeholders
    Knowledge of and willingness to comply with all TSSAA rules and regulations
    Must meet all district and state coaching certification requirements
    CPR/First Aid certification (or willingness to obtain)
